Brief summary

This trial is conducted in Asia, Europe, and North and South America. The trial consists of a main trial and a sub-trial. The main trial investigates safety and efficacy of turoctocog alfa (recombinant factor VIII, rFVIII (N8)) in haemophilia A subjects, while the sub-trial investigates safety and efficacy of turoctocog alfa in prevention and treatment of bleeding episodes during surgical procedures.

Interventions

Subjects will receive bleeding preventive treatment (home treatment with self-injection i.v.) with turoctocog alfa at a dose of 20-40 IU/kg body weight every second day or 20-50 IU/kg body weight three times per week at the investigator's discretion.

Inclusion criteria

* Male subjects with the diagnosis of severe (FVIII less than or equal to 1%) haemophilia A from age 12 (except for Israel where the age limit will be 18 for the first 10 subjects recruited in the trial) to 56 years having a weight of 10 to 120 kg * Documented history of at least 150 exposure days to any other FVIII products (prevention or treatment of bleeds) * No history of FVIII inhibitors greater than or equal to 0.6 BU/mL. The inhibitor should be measured regularly for at least the last 8 years or since the first treatment of haemophilia A * No detectable inhibitors to FVIII (greater than or equal to 0.6 BU/mL) (as assessed by a Central Laboratory at the time of screening)

Exclusion criteria

* Congenital or acquired coagulation disorders other than haemophilia A * Creatinine levels 50% above normal level (as defined by central laboratory range) * Known or suspected allergy to trial product (N8) or related products

Outcome results

Primary

The Incidence Rate of FVIII Inhibitors (Greater Than or Equal to 0.6 Bethesda Units (BU))

The incidence rate of FVIII inhibitors was calculated by including all patients with inhibitors in the nominator and including all patients with a minimum 50 exposure plus any patients with less than 50 exposures but with inhibitors in denominator.

Time frame: The adverse events were collected throughout the trial, corresponding to an average of 188 days per subject.

Population: The safety analysis set includes all 150 subjects who received at least one dose of the investigational product. The analysis of the primary endpoint included all subjects with at least 50 exposure days and/or with inhibitors. A total of 148 subjects had 50 exposure days (EDs).

ArmMeasureValue (NUMBER)
All Subjects Treated With Turoctocog AlfaThe Incidence Rate of FVIII Inhibitors (Greater Than or Equal to 0.6 Bethesda Units (BU))0 N with Inhibitors / N with ≥50 EDs
